在不使用 GoSub 的情况下返回(错误 3)

Return 语句必须具有相应的 GoSub 语句。 此错误的原因和解决方案如下:

  • 某个 Return 语句没有相匹配的 GoSub 语句。 请确保 GoSub 语句没有被意外删除。
  • VBA 中的返回值的含义与 Visual Basic .NET 中的含义不同。
  • 如果要在 VBA 中退出 Sub ,请使用 Exit Sub 而不是 Return

与在编译时匹配的 For...NextWhile...WendSub...End Sub 不同,GoSubReturn运行时匹配。 有关其他信息,选择有问题的项并按 F1(在 Windows 中)或 HELP(在 Macintosh 上)。

支持和反馈

有关于 Office VBA 或本文档的疑问或反馈? 请参阅 Office VBA 支持和反馈,获取有关如何接收支持和提供反馈的指南。